What is a USDA Rural Housing Service loan?

The Rural Housing Service (RHS) offers mortgage programs that can help low- to moderate-income rural residents purchase, construct, and repair homes. 

The RHS both lends directly to qualified borrowers and guarantees loans that meet RHS program requirements made by approved lenders.
